What Is a Face and Neck Lift?
A face and neck lift (rhytidectomy) repositions deeper facial tissues, tightens underlying muscles, and removes excess skin to restore definition along the jawline, cheeks, and neck. When performed correctly, the result looks natural, leaving patients appearing refreshed rather than tight or over-operated.
This procedure specifically targets the lower third of the face and the neck, addressing jowls, skin laxity, and vertical platysmal bands that develop over time.
For patients who have experienced significant weight loss, including those using GLP-1 medications such as semaglutide, a lift is often combined with facial fat grafting to restore volume in the cheeks and temples while tightening the skin.
How Is a Face and Neck Lift Procedure Performed?
A face and neck lift is performed under general anaesthesia or intravenous sedation and takes between 3 to 5 hours, depending on the complexity and whether additional procedures are combined. The procedure follows a structured surgical sequence:
- Incision placement: Incisions are carefully made along the hairline, extending around the ears and sometimes into the lower scalp. This placement allows access to deeper tissues while keeping scars discreet.
- Tissue repositioning (SMAS layer): The surgeon lifts and repositions the SMAS (Superficial Musculoaponeurotic System), the structural layer beneath the skin. This step is critical, as it restores natural facial contours rather than simply tightening the skin.
- Neck muscle tightening: In the neck area, the platysma muscle is tightened to eliminate vertical banding and improve definition under the chin and along the jawline.
- Excess skin removal: Loose skin is redraped over the newly contoured structure, and any excess is carefully removed without creating tension.
- Closure and dressing: Incisions are closed with fine sutures, and light dressings or compression garments are applied to support healing and reduce swelling.
In some cases, surgeons combine the procedure with fat grafting to restore volume or liposuction to refine the neck contour. The goal is always a balanced, natural-looking result rather than an over-tightened appearance.
How Long Do Face and Neck Lift Results Last?
Face and neck lift results last 10 to 15 years, but this range does not tell the full story. The procedure does not stop aging. After surgery, the face continues to age at a normal pace, but from a more youthful baseline. This means that even 10–15 years later, patients still look younger than they would have without the procedure. Several factors directly influence how long results last such as age at the time of surgery, skin quality and elasticity, sun exposure, lifestyle factors, and surgical technique.
The jawline may gradually soften again, and mild skin laxity can return, particularly in the neck. However, the face does not “go back” to its pre-surgery state.
For most patients, a face and neck lift is a long-term investment rather than a temporary fix, delivering structural improvement that remains visible for over a decade.

What Can You Expect During Recovery?
Most patients stay 7 to 10 days in Istanbul before flying home. Swelling and bruising are expected in the first few days, peaking around days 2 and 3 and managed with prescribed medication. Most patients describe the sensation as tightness rather than sharp pain. By the end of week 2, the majority of visible bruising has faded and the new contours of the jawline and neck begin to emerge clearly.
Strenuous physical activity should be avoided for around 6 weeks to protect the incisions as they heal. Incisions follow the hairline and sit in front of and behind the ear. In skilled hands, these heal to thin lines that are nearly invisible within months.

Yes, it is possible to achieve mild lifting and tightening effects without surgery, but the results are limited compared to a surgical face and neck lift.
Non-surgical options focus on stimulating collagen production or mechanically lifting the skin rather than repositioning deeper tissues. These face lift without a surgery treatments options are best suited for early signs of aging, such as mild skin laxity or slight loss of definition. Common non-surgical alternatives include thread lifts (spider web lift), ultrasound-based treatments (e.g., HIFU), radiofrequency treatments, and dermal fillers.
While these methods involve minimal downtime, they do not address deeper structural aging, excess skin, or significant sagging. For moderate to advanced aging, a surgical face and neck lift remains the most effective and long-lasting solution.
